The San Diego City Council this week decided — with the mayor's urging and the city attorney's opposition — to settle its lawsuit against Cisterra and CGA Capital.
This $132-million-dollar decision paves the way for the city to buy its two most problematic buildings that were caught up in the suit and kick off what could be its most ambitious development project ever.
This week, we discuss what went down in the council meeting ahead of the decision and all of the lofty ideas that are getting packed into this project.
